devoted almost wholly to the Comedy: -It was an epic poem, but it was also a historical document of remark able importance. It was a series of vivid pictures, but the work of one well-versed in theology, though it con tained an accurate record of the warld's knowledge of the natural sciences in the age when it was writ ten. It was a quarry for the lover, the poet or the student. High above all brooded the cold spirit of Catholic dogma.
It recorded an epoch in the. li'e of what in the opinion of the lecturer was the most intersting community In his concluding remarks Mr. de that has ever existed. It was the Martin said he had not attempted to very nucleus of the most beautiful go very far below the surface of his European language of to-day-the subject; still less had be tried to first words Italy had said."And not explain. He amused his audience only had Dante garnered for us the with the story of the little girl gold of Italy and 'coined it into the who was studying history at home. language which is to some degres Mother, I think I should understand current in the cultivated circles of all civilised countries, but it had been the fountainhead of all that at and song which made Italy the forster-fatherland of every man or wo man with any pretensions to literary or artistic tastes. He deeply in- fluenced not only the literature and poetry that came after him but even the painting and kindred arts whose achievements remain the standards and eritoria of the artistic world at the present day!
